Ontology Term : Eukaryotic host translation shutoff by virus UniProtKeyword

description  Viral protein involved in inhibiting the host translational machinery to shutoff cellular gene expression. This gives virus transcripts a competitive edge to use the hijacked translation machinery. Preventing the expression of host proteins is also a strategy to counteract the antiviral response. Several virus are known to inhibit host translation mostly by inactivating translation factors
